Digital Coupons

Basically, digital coupons are discount coupons, offers, and promotions offered by online retailers and businesses to their current and potential customers. Digital coupons serve the same purpose as their physical counterparts: but to entice consumers to make an online purchase.

In what way do digital coupons serve a purpose?

It has been shown that coupons can increase the number of shopping trips and basket sizes. In addition, with the growth of digital online businesses and e-commerce, more shoppers are searching online for discounts and bargain hunting.

Is it necessary to print digital coupons?

As the name suggests, digital coupons enable consumers to redeem them electronically without having to print out a coupon. No printing is required.

Digital Tickets

By using our digital tickets product, you can significantly reduce event administration tasks such as organising tickets, sending them out, collecting them and tallying them at the event.

Digital tickets take much of the hard work out of the equation. Tickets can be sent out instantly, ticket types can be modified, cancelled & lost tickets can be reissued, and so forth.

Users can access and download digital tickets directly from their online wallets (such as Apple Wallet and Google Wallet). QR codes are printed on the tickets, which are scanned by the event organisers at the door. A computerised database of all tickets sold keeps track of who showed up and who did not.
